In this easy-to-read book, Simon Lewis explores why some digital products are so hard to use, and offers three straightforward but powerful ways to make interacting with them much easier. Written for software engineers, project and product managers, designers, marketers, CEOs and entrepreneurs, Taming the Turing Machine shows why the machine that can do anything has become the machine that does everything. And the machine that does everything has left many of us confused.
